    Abstract: A method for manufacturing a hardened casing for a vane pump is disclosed. The method includes providing a vane pump casing; hardening the casing by (i) cleaning the casing with a high pressure fluid containing abrasive material, (ii) loading the casing in a furnace, (iii) purging the furnace with an inert gas followed by purging the furnace with ammonia, (iv) conducting a first heating of the casing in the furnace at a first temperature of about 1200° F. for a time period of about 4 hours, (v) conducting a second heating of the casing in the furnace at a second temperature of about 1000° F. for a time period of about 4 hours, and (vi) cooling the casing and purging the furnace with an inert gas before removing the casing.

    Abstract: A piston for diesel engine applications has a piston body cast entirely of one piece of steel and includes a piston head with a combustion bowl, a ring belt and an oil cooling gallery. A pair of pin bosses and a piston skirt are cast as one piece with the piston head out of the same steel material.

    Abstract: A rotary compressor comprises a cylinder having an inner space and a groove, a roller sliding along the inside of the inner space of the cylinder, a vane penetrating through the groove, and refrigerant. The groove penetrates through the outside and inner space of the cylinder. The vane slides on the roller, and the vane also slides in and out of the groove. The vane includes stainless steel formed by sintering of powder material, a nitrogen diffusion layer disposed on the surface of the stainless steel, and a compound layer of iron and nitrogen disposed on the surface of the nitrogen diffusion layer. The stainless steel has a plurality of fine pores formed by sintering of powder material. The plurality of fine pores have a porosity of 15% or less.

    Abstract: A cylinder head has a cast iron body member, one end of which is recessed to accommodate a circular disk-like insert of an iron, chromium, nickel alloy. The insert forms one wall of the water jacket portion of the cylinder head, and its external surface provides the combustion surface of the cylinder head. The periphery of the insert is spaced inwardly of the bolt holes and water ports of the cylinder head. The insert also has boss portions which form the lower part of the valve port bosses and the injector boss. The insert is brazed to the body member at its periphery and at the abutting boss portions. The flange at the opposite end of the cylinder head is cast steel. When fabricated as a new part, the body member may be of cast steel and integral with the flange.
